WebStanding in rows, vigorous banana trees tower over a mix of kalo (taro), ‘awa (kava) and wauke (paper mulberry). Growing in plantations of multi-layered crops alongside bananas, the plants recreate a landscape of Hawai’i ancestors where heavy clusters of fruit cascade down in a multitude of colors, shapes and sizes.

WebMar 1, 2024 · Bananas need lots of water — the plant and its fruit consist of 90 percent water — so 127 inches of the stuff annually is a boon. But funguses and nematodes thrive in such moist conditions, too. Ha knows well how quickly they can destroy healthy bananas. Caterpillars, which love to eat bananas, tend to proliferate in the wet, warm climate ...
